World Book Club - Sebastian Faulks
Join Sebastian Faulks for a discussion of his novel 'Bird Song' for the World Book Club
Put your 'Birdsong' question to Sebastian Faulks in Bush House this April.
Each month the BBC World Service, with presenter Harriet Gilbert, host a discussion with an internationally renowned author to discuss their most popular novel.
April is the month of Sebastian Faulks who will be discussing his internationally renowned WW1 historical saga 'Birdsong'.
Sebastian Faulks talks about his book in Bush House on Thursday April 3rd from 6pm. To be part of the audience email your details to the World Book Club.
